Welcome to our website. We are glad that we can share the Lord's ministry at Bethlehem with you! Our mission is to call people to repentance and faith in Jesus Christ; and, to build disciples who love and follow the Lord wholeheartedly.

Bethlehem Evangelical Lutheran Church has been a part of the Morris, Illinois community since 1880. We are thankful for our past; it is a rich spiritual heritage filled with many blessings. And, we are enthused about our future as the Word of God is proclaimed and more people come alive in Christ!Sign

Keep looking to Jesus for He is as He said, "the way, the truth, and the life, and no one comes to the Father but through Me" (John 14:6). May your visit to our website encourage you spiritually in your walk with the Lord.

"With what shall I come before the LORD, and bow myself before God on High?

Shall I come before him with burnt offerings, with calves a year old?

Will the LORD be pleased with thousands of rams, with ten thousands of rivers of oil?

Shall I give my firstborn for my transgression, the fruit of my body for the sin of my soul?

He has told you, O man, what is good; and what does the LORD require of you

but to do justice, and to love kindness, and to walk humbly with your God?"

Micah 6: 6-8 (ESV)
